67 Pa. Code § 171.125 - Seating

(a) Vehicle seats. Vehicle seats and seat belts shall be of a type and installed as recommended by the vehicle manufacturer.
(b) Dividers. Dividers may not be used to separate the seats.
(c) Seating space. A designated seating position of safe design and construction shall be provided for each passenger and a passenger may not be carried for which a safe designated seating position is not available. Seats shall be forward facing.
(d) Child passenger restraints. Drivers of school vehicles are required to comply with the requirements of 75 Pa.C.S. § 4581 (relating to child passenger restraints) and the Department's regulations implementing those requirements.

Notes

67 Pa. Code § 171.125
The provisions of this § 171.125 adopted August 19, 1983, effective 8/20/1983, 13 Pa.B. 2561; readopted December 4, 1987, effective 12/5/1987, 17 Pa.B. 5052; amended September 13, 1996, effective 9/14/1996, 26 Pa.B. 4411; amended May 20, 2005, effective 5/21/2005, 35 Pa.B. 3039.

The provisions of this § 171.125 amended under the Vehicle Code, 75 Pa.C.S. §§ 4103, 4551-4553 and 6103.
